* feat(items): one shared parse for a --field key=value entry (BUG-2870) Six sites parsed that entry independently — item create, list, update, move and copy in cmd/pad, plus ingestFieldKVP on the remote /mcp door — in four spellings, and they disagreed about what it meant. The CLI sites used both halves verbatim, so `--field " effort=l"` stored an undeclared field named " effort" and left the declared `effort` untouched; the remote door trimmed both halves and wrote `effort`. Same call, two stored keys, decided by which transport the caller was on. This is the helper only; the call sites move over in the commits that follow. Two rules, deliberately asymmetric, per the day-60 ruling: - a KEY whose trimmed form differs from what was written is REFUSED at every door, rather than silently retargeted to a different field; - a VALUE is carried VERBATIM at every door, because trimming reinterprets a caller's bytes and on a text field the space is content. A padded value against a typed field is refused one layer down by validation, naming the field — measured, not assumed. ErrFieldEntryMalformed is returned rather than handled because the six sites deliberately disagree about a malformed entry (four skip it, copy hard-errors) and unifying that is a separate decision. Claude-Session: https://claude.ai/code/session_01HeChkgZVYb3NTgTcckF5KR * fix(cli,mcp): all six --field parse sites go through the one helper (BUG-2870) item create, list, update, move and copy in cmd/pad, plus ingestFieldKVP on the remote /mcp door, now call items.SplitFieldEntry instead of each rolling its own split. A padded key is refused at every door; a value reaches every door verbatim. Two sites keep something specific to them, both documented in place: - `item list` is a READ filter, and it takes the same key rule deliberately: a padded key there filters on a field nobody declared and returns empty, which is indistinguishable from "no rows match". - `item move` gets KEY normalisation only. Its values stay strings because the server types a declared field on that path too, so a clean `--field n=3` already stores the number 3 — measured before the change. Each site keeps its historical disposition toward a MALFORMED entry (four skip silently, copy hard-errors), which is why the helper classifies that case rather than deciding it. NOT YET EVIDENCE: ./internal/mcp, ./cmd/pad and ./internal/items all pass, and that green does not show the divergence closed — the three BUG-2850 pinned tests exercise the catalog conflict pass, which never reaches ingestFieldKVP. The door-level test and the re-grounding of that pass are the next commits.
